Can a hvac technician afford rent in Sheridan, IN?
Median rent in Sheridan is $2,050 a month. A typical hvac technician in Indiana earns about $52,716 a year, which makes that rent 46.7%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is no — rent exceeds the 30% threshold.
How much rent can a hvac technician afford in Sheridan?
Using the 30% rule, a hvac technician salary in Indiana (~$52,716/yr) supports up to $1,318 a month in rent. Sheridan's current median rent is $2,050/mo, which is $732/mo over the affordability threshold.
How many hours does a hvac technician work to cover rent in Sheridan?
At an hourly equivalent of about $25 an hour, a hvac technician in Indiana works roughly 80.9 hours a month to cover Sheridan's median rent of $2,050.
